397c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ate /*
407c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* buffer size (used for tx/rx operations)
417c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  */
427c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	DP_BUFFER_SIZE	2048
437c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 
447c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ate /*
457c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* Number of tx/rx buffers. there are 2 (static) buffers: receive buffer and
467c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* send buffer. These buffers are basically used by the protocol to packetize
477c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* a message to be sent OR to collect data received from the serial device.
487c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* Currently, we just need two for send and receive operations respectively
497c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* since there is only one request/response session per time (i.e. a new
507c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* session is not started until the previous one has not finished)
517c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  */
527c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	DP_BUFFER_COUNT		2
537c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 
547c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	DP_TX_BUFFER		0
557c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	DP_RX_BUFFER		1
567c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 
577c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ate /*
587c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* Tx/Rx buffers.
597c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  */
607c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ate typedef struct dp_buffer {
617c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 	boolean_t in_use;
627c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 	uint8_t buf[DP_BUFFER_SIZE];
637c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ate } dp_buffer_t;
647c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 
657c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ate /*
667c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* Data structure used to collect data from the serial device and to
677c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* assemble protocol packets
687c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  */
697c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 
707c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ate /*
717c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* The possible states the message receiver can be in:
727c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  */
737c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	WAITING_FOR_SYNC	0
747c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	WAITING_FOR_SYNC_ESC	1
757c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	WAITING_FOR_HDR		2
767c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	RECEIVING_HDR		3
777c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	RECEIVING_HDR_ESC	4
787c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	RECEIVING_BODY		5
797c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	RECEIVING_BODY_ESC	6
807c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ate #define	N_RX_STATES		7
817c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 
827c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ate /*
837c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* This is the structure passed between the message receiver state routines.
847c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* It keeps track of all the state of a message that is in the process of
857c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  * being received.
867c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ate  */
877c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ate typedef struct dp_packet {
887c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 	uint8_t rx_state;	/* Current state of receive engine. */
897c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 	uint8_t *inbuf;		/* Input characters to be processed. */
907c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 	int16_t inbuflen;	/* Number of input characters. */
917c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 	uint8_t *buf;		/* Buffer used to receive current message. */
927c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 	int16_t bufpos;		/* Position in buffer. */
937c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ate 	int16_t full_length;	/* Full length of this message. */
947c478bd9Sstevel@tonic-gate } dp_packet_t;
